Apparently they started life as 525sc's. They were upgraded earlier to 250's. Guy buys boat and then the rear bearings on one of the 250's lets go and trashes the rotors. Guy eventually wants to go bigger so he went with the 8-71's. Just using what he has and taming down the 8-71's a little for the time being. Should be a good build over the winter.
